**Ticket: Drift detected during ORM refactor**

While refactoring the legacy Cobblewright ORM layer out of the Merrowfield billing service, we found its database settings diverge from the values pinned in our Tallowgate manifests. The runtime copy enables verbose query logging and a wider connection pool, neither of which was ever reviewed. Since the logging setting may capture sensitive query parameters, flagging this for security review before we normalize. The live values pulled from the host are as follows.

service settings:
PRAIX_LOG_LEVEL=error
PRAIX_METRICS_HOST=metrics.praix.qorvelcorp.corp
PRAIX_POOL_SIZE=16

### Runbook: BounceBroom — Account Recovery

If the BounceBroom email bounce processor loses access to its service account, do not create a new one. First, pause the intake queue so bounces buffer safely. Then open the recovery console and select the BounceBroom principal. Verification requires approval from the on-call lead. Once approved, the console prompts for the stored recovery credentials; enter the passphrase that appears directly below this paragraph.

recovery phrase for fahof-kahap: holion-gormir-jorix-istix-briwyn-sorael

**Handover — firmware update channel (Dray → Okonma), for the eng sync.** The Wrenfield devices pull updates from the beta channel every six hours; promotion to stable is manual and gated on the soak dashboard staying green for 48 hours. Rollbacks are automatic if the health beacon misses three consecutive check-ins. Please don't change the staggering window without looping in the hardware team in Velmont — older units brown out on simultaneous flashes. The channel service starts with the following configuration values.

config for tawif-bagef:
[sorwyn]
team = sorys
access_code = ac_9ba40c
host = sorwyn.ordingrid.local
port = 5000
owner = aldok.quenion
peer = belath.paliqcloud.local